vimarsana.com
Home
1st Run Computer Services Inc
Top Locations Tagged with 1st Run Computer Services Inc
1st Run Computer Services Inc in United States - 11530/Supermarket near Nassau
1). 1ST Run Computer Services
1st Run Computer Services Inc in United States - 10001/Computer-service near New York
2). 1st Run Computer Svces, Broadway Rm
vimarsana © 2020. All Rights Reserved.